Atlanta Ladies Memorial Association records

 Collection
Collection number: ahc.MSS375
Scope and Content

This collection contains organizational records and histories of the Atlanta Ladies Memorial Association. Also included are historical items collected by members as well as newspaper clippings, programs, and membership information. There are files pertaining to member genealogy and biographies of Confederate soldiers.

Dates: 1866-1977

Mary Lucas Butler Collection

 Collection
Collection number: ahc.MSS236
Scope and Content A large portion of this collection consists of papers written about, or by, Fred Lucas and his sister Mary Lucas Butler. These papers include biographical information of Fred Lucas and college research papers written by Mary Lucas. Poetry and book reviews are also part of this collection. A particular part of the collection includes biographical and genealogical materials about Madame Sophie Sosnowski (1833-1899), an immigrant to Georgia from Poland. Thornton family collection

 Collection
Collection number: ahc.MSS320
Scope and Content

This collection contains genealogical information pertaining to the Thornton family. Included is correspondence, family histories, and miscellaneous materials pertaining property owned by family members.

Dates: 1899-1927
